Arizona Cardinals quarterback Carson Beck is navigating a difficult preseason stretch, sidelined by a persistent rib injury that kept him out of Saturday’s matchup against the Dallas Cowboys. The Cardinals ultimately fell to the Cowboys in a 34-13 defeat.
Despite the setback, Carson remains focused on his recovery. On Monday, he posted a series of images to his Instagram account, highlighting moments from the Cardinals’ earlier Hall of Fame Game against the Carolina Panthers. His sister, Kylie Beck, who is a member of the Miami Dolphins cheerleading squad, offered a brief but supportive four-word reaction to the post, acknowledging the “ebbs and flows” of his current professional journey.
The road to recovery has been inconsistent for the young quarterback. While Carson participated in a throwing session prior to the Dallas game—raising hopes for a potential return to the field—he was ultimately benched as he continued to experience discomfort from his rib injury. This ongoing physical struggle has created a challenging start to his NFL career, characterized by a series of highs and lows.
Arizona head coach Mike LaFleur provided an update on the situation during a media session on Monday. While LaFleur noted that the quarterback’s recent throwing session was positive, he stopped short of confirming whether Carson would be cleared to play in the team’s final preseason game this Friday, when the Cardinals travel to Lambeau Field to face the Green Bay Packers.
The siblings have both been marking significant milestones in their respective professional athletic careers this summer. Kylie Beck officially joined the Miami Dolphins’ cheerleading team in June, a career move she celebrated on social media by sharing photos in her uniform and expressing deep gratitude for her family’s unwavering support throughout her journey.
Kylie made her debut as a Dolphins cheerleader during the team’s preseason game against the New York Giants this past Saturday. She commemorated the occasion by posting images of herself in her official cheerleading attire, marking a high point in her own professional development while simultaneously standing by her brother as he works to overcome his injury hurdles.
